今天小编给大家带来的是java如何写出优雅的代码,希望能帮助到大家!
工具/原料
1
PC
2
java
方法/步骤
1
一、不要使用魔法数字,尽量定义枚举、常量、宏:我常常见到表示各种状态的数字,0,1,2....,我真的不知道这表示什么含义,如果,你在不在文档中说明的话,这个东东过几天连你自己都不知道个一二三了。
2
二、命名要具有描述力,尽量使用全名而不是自创的缩写,除非地球人都这么用这个缩写:我常常看到一些自创的缩写,这个缩写或许只有你自己知道,类名,方法名,参数名。
3
尤其要有好的描述里,局部变量尚可容忍。我宁可容忍超过40个字符的命令,也不愿意,看到只有一两个字母的命名,当然迭代用的i,j除外。当然命名不要太长,太长说明你的类和方法要做的事情太多,请你拆分出更多细粒度功能单一的类和方法。
4
三、同一类东东命名方式尽可能统一,比如类名使用大写字母开头的单词,变量使用,下划线分割开来的小写字母单词,常量使用下滑线分割的开来的大写字母单词。不要交替使用。
5
四、函数、类功能尽可能单一,不要试图写一个万能/超级函数或者类。一个类和方法要有单一的职责,这样的类和方法只做一件事,并且容易把他做好。
注意事项
1
网络虽好,但要注意劳逸结合哦!
2
如果是青少年,小编在这里提示大家千万不能沉迷网络!
上一篇:拒绝被忽悠,避开婚纱摄影的陷阱
下一篇:如何婉拒婚纱摄影中的隐性消费